Howard Beck ‏ @HowardBeckNYT
Baron Davis' knee injury much worse than thought: partial tear of patella tendon, complete tears of ACL and MCL. 12 month recovery

05-07-2012, 05:38 PM
Just like I said. I LOL'd when they said maybe no structural damage. People saying "It's not that bad, just a dislocated knee".

The Patella is quite motile so there is a chance of it being dislocated without rupturing any ligaments. That's just not the case for Baron, but otherwise a dislodged patella is quite common and recovery is no longer then 4-6 weeks.
